New Rolls-Royce Wraith

The vehicle was inspired by the film And the World Stood Still, a dramatic short film created to coincide with the launch of the original model. The film was recently accepted into the British Film Institute National Archives and to celebrate, the English car manufacturer created a slightly film noir version of their most powerful vehicle to date. 

References to the genre are seen through a unique two-tone Silver and Jubilee Silver paint scheme, while a solid-silver hand-cast Spirit of Ecstasy acts as the femme fatale to the leading man. Opening the doors, the interior is more colorful than the exterior suggests. Performance aspects include a shorter wheelbase, wider rear track and 624 bhp/465 kW derived from the twin turbo V12. Drivers will be going from 0 to 60 in 4.4 seconds.
